Gold Futures Rise In Divergent Trading

Gold futures increased Rs29 to Rs73,525 per 10 grams as speculators created fresh positions on a firm spot demand. Silver futures fell Rs28 to Rs89,581 per kilogram as participants reduced their bets. On Multi Commodity Exchange (MCX), gold contracts for October delivery traded higher Rs29 or 0.04 per cent at Rs73,525 per 10 grams in a business turnover of 14,680 lots. Fresh positions built up by participants led to a rise in gold prices, analysts said. Globally, gold futures increased 0.10 per cent to $2,611.60 per ounce in New York. On MCX, silver contracts for December delivery marginally declined by Rs28 or 0.03 per cent to Rs89,581 per kg in a business turnover of 25,956 lots. Globally, silver was trading 0.18 per cent lower at $31.19 per ounce in New York.
